| Career Path | What You Will Learn In This Free Course • Describe the scope and settings of the pharmacy sector within healthcare services. • Explain the UK regulatory framework governing pharmacy practice. • Identify core pharmacy services and their connection to patient pathways. • Outline roles, boundaries, and delegation within pharmacy work environments. • Apply standard operating procedures to support safe pharmacy workflows. • Assess quality systems used for continuous improvement in pharmacy operations. • Analyse inventory management and supply chain processes in pharmacy settings. • Define ethical and professional conduct standards in pharmacy practice. • Indicate the purpose of health information systems used in pharmacies. • State legal requirements for prescription intake and drug dispensing. • Recognise communication challenges linked to health literacy and language access. • Evaluate workplace and medication safety risks through reporting practices. |
